Industrial Control and Drive Interface Characteristics

The GE CM400RGICH1ADC applies industrial drive control principles for high-power converter operation. It receives low-level PWM signals from the converter controller and generates isolated gate pulses for IGBT switching devices. Therefore, the module maintains separation between control electronics and high-voltage power circuits.

In addition, the board supports galvanic isolation methods to reduce electrical stress caused by switching transients. The interface design follows GE industrial converter architectures, where signal integrity, I/O density scaling, and firmware flash compatibility depend on the complete converter control platform configuration.

The module operates as part of a GE power conversion assembly and provides controlled switching coordination between the main controller and IGBT phase hardware.

Frequently Asked Questions

Q: What is the primary function of the GE CM400RGICH1ADC?
A: The module processes PWM control signals and drives high-power IGBT phase assemblies through isolated gate control outputs.

Q: Does the CM400RGICH1ADC directly control the wind turbine generator output?
A: No. The module performs gate drive and interface functions inside the converter power stage. The main converter controller manages overall power regulation.

Q: Does the module require electrical isolation during installation?
A: Yes. The installation must maintain isolation practices because the board interfaces with high-voltage IGBT switching circuits and low-voltage control electronics.

Field Installation Guidelines

  • Install the CM400RGICH1ADC according to the GE converter cabinet wiring documentation and approved maintenance procedures.
  • Verify all control and power connections before energizing the converter system.
  • Keep PWM signal wiring separated from high-current power conductors to reduce electromagnetic interference.
  • Connect cable shields according to the converter grounding design to minimize switching noise.
  • Inspect connectors, terminal interfaces, and mounting points for contamination or mechanical damage before operation.
  • Confirm that the associated IGBT phase assembly and protection circuits operate correctly after installation.
